Transaction ddf02f0b4ff253c93ff4d35803ec7558ee5042c7b2a85968676b23440650ec01
1 Input
1 Output
-
ddf02f0b4ff253c93ff4d35803ec7558ee5042c7b2a85968676b23440650ec01:0
- value
- 377616775
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54601234abac13eb9eabad72b3e362eaad34f8f4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18h8rFcVnc8usAhHkT34wE7ekuTwvwFtqj